Doppelganger Disclaimer

I do not have a doppelganger. There’s no evil twin
wandering around within the world I’m in.
So any malfeasance—any scrape or sin
that has occurred in any place where I might have been
please attribute just to me. I will take all the blame.
Blaming a doppelganger would be to share my fame.
Sometimes I am a stinker, but at other times most jolly.
I’m responsible for all of me—both bravery and folly.
As a denizen of this fair world, until I pull up stakes,
I think it’s only fair that I claim my own mistakes!
